Pārlūkot izejas kodu

Adding support for setting TRANSMISSION_WEB_HOME env var, #255

master
Kristian Haugene pirms 6 gadiem
vecāks
revīzija
b462cdda42
3 mainītis faili ar 6 papildinājumiem un 2 dzēšanām
  1. 2
    1
      Dockerfile
  2. 3
    0
      transmission/environment-variables.tmpl
  3. 1
    1
      transmission/start.sh

+ 2
- 1
Dockerfile Parādīt failu

@@ -106,7 +106,8 @@ ENV OPENVPN_USERNAME=**None** \
"TRANSMISSION_HOME=/data/transmission-home" \
"ENABLE_UFW=false" \
PUID=\
PGID=
PGID=\
TRANSMISSION_WEB_HOME=

# Expose port and run
EXPOSE 9091

+ 3
- 0
transmission/environment-variables.tmpl Parādīt failu

@@ -77,3 +77,6 @@ export ENABLE_UFW={{ .Env.ENABLE_UFW }}

export PUID={{ .Env.PUID }}
export PGID={{ .Env.PGID }}

# Support custom web frontend
{{ if .Env.TRANSMISSION_WEB_HOME }} export TRANSMISSION_WEB_HOME={{ .Env.TRANSMISSION_WEB_HOME }} {{end}}

+ 1
- 1
transmission/start.sh Parādīt failu

@@ -22,7 +22,7 @@ fi
. /etc/transmission/userSetup.sh

echo "STARTING TRANSMISSION"
exec sudo -u ${RUN_AS} /usr/bin/transmission-daemon -g ${TRANSMISSION_HOME} --logfile ${TRANSMISSION_HOME}/transmission.log &
exec sudo -E -u ${RUN_AS} /usr/bin/transmission-daemon -g ${TRANSMISSION_HOME} --logfile ${TRANSMISSION_HOME}/transmission.log &

if [ "$OPENVPN_PROVIDER" = "PIA" ]
then

Notiek ielāde…
Atcelt
Saglabāt